Les valeurs SMART ont-elles un sens?

1

Est-il possible de comprendre les valeurs SMART?

Voici un exemple de valeurs affichées pour l'un de mes lecteurs:

entrez la description de l'image ici

Les questions suivantes se posent:

  1. Si le nombre de secteurs réaffectés est égal à 2 et le seuil égal à 36, pourquoi est-il marqué en rouge? Le seuil n'est pas encore dépassé!
  2. Qu'est-ce que le FB3? De l'hex, il est 4019, c'est-à-dire ni 36 ni 2. Où a-t-il pris les valeurs?
  3. Le nombre actuel de secteurs en attente est égal à 100 et le seuil à 0. Le seuil est dépassé. Pourquoi est-il marqué en jaune alors, pas en rouge?
  4. Pourquoi y a-t-il tant de valeurs 100? On dirait que c'est la valeur de stub. Comment peut-il connaître le statut alors, si la valeur est stubbed?
  5. C'est quoi B? De l'hex, il est 11. Ni 0, ni 100. Où est-ce que ça vaut aussi?

Ainsi, la seule valeur compréhensible est la couleur du bouton situé à gauche, tandis que toutes les autres valeurs sont remplies de délire. Est-il possible de comprendre quelque chose ici?

Notez que, pour une raison quelconque, ce délire est répété d’une application SMART à une autre.

Dims
la source
Lecture intéressante: backblaze.com/blog/hard-drive-smart-stats --- Selon cette statistique, votre disque a un taux d'échec annuel de 150%. Remplacez / Sauvegardez-le dès que possible si vous vous souciez des données!
Mpy

Réponses:

1

Current , Worst , Threshold sont des valeurs normalisées par opposition aux valeurs brutes .

  1. Le disque dur a 0xFB3 (4019) secteurs réaffectés, ce qui donne un score actuel normalisé de 2, bien en dessous du seuil de 36.
  2. Valeurs brutes renvoyées par les capteurs / compteurs internes.
  3. Le disque dur a 0xB (11) secteurs en attente de réallocation.
  4. Bonne question! Je suppose que ces attributs ne sont peut-être pas critiques et que le fabricant ne se donne pas la peine de les normaliser correctement.
guest-vm
la source
1
  1. Parce que la valeur réelle des secteurs réaffectés est 4019 (c'est la valeur brute qui représente le nombre de secteurs défectueux qui ont été trouvés et remappés), ce qui dépasse de beaucoup la valeur de drapeau 2 (qui est 36).

  2. FB3 est 4019 en HEX.

  3. Parce que la valeur réelle (hex: B = 11) n'est pas proche de 100, plus précisément, dans votre cas, 100-11 n'est pas encore proche de 0. Voir 5. (lié).

  4. Ils sont choisis par le fabricant.

  5. Certaines valeurs sont définies par défaut sur max et décrémentent ou sont basées sur des différences par rapport à 100 (ou autres valeurs). Voir 3. (liés).

Fondamentalement, ce sont les valeurs brutes qui, dans de nombreux cas, devraient vous intéresser beaucoup.

La conclusion est que votre disque dur a trop de secteurs réaffectés et quelques secteurs non corrigibles. vous devriez envisager le remplacement.

Voici quelques bonnes informations sur le sujet.

En ce qui concerne les valeurs:

  • Courant / normalisé: il s'agit de la valeur ci-dessus normalisée, de sorte qu'une valeur élevée est toujours préférable pour la plupart des valeurs (le total R / W est un exemple d'exception). Le temps de mise en route est donc meilleur que 94. Cela peut également varier d’un fabricant à l’autre, ce qui peut créer de la confusion.

  • Worst: La valeur normalisée la plus mauvaise que votre disque dur a eu par le passé (des valeurs telles que 99 ou 199 sont les paramètres par défaut courants).

  • Seuil: lorsque la valeur normalisée est inférieure à cette valeur, le disque dur est susceptible d’échouer. Notez votre valeur 36 par rapport au brut. C'est pourquoi c'est rouge.

  • Valeur réelle / brute: Il s'agit de la valeur brute indiquée par le contrôleur. La plupart du temps, il s'agit d'une valeur facile à comprendre, mais elle peut également varier d'un fabricant à l'autre.

Surmente
la source
Je suppose que votre explication du point 3 est correcte. Il existe deux types de paramètres SMART: pre-fail et old_age (voir cette question par exemple). Mon estimation est que le rouge indique un problème avec le paramètre pre-fail, le jaune est un problème avec le paramètre old_age.
gronostaj
La plus grande partie de la confusion provient de la façon dont ils sont comptés. Certaines valeurs augmentent jusqu'à une valeur maximale de la ligne rouge (N), certaines diminuent jusqu'à 0 de NV (N - valeur de référence, V - valeur actuelle). Dans le cas "jaune" actuel, il n'est pas important que les erreurs se produisent, car elles sont en attente (les secteurs n'ont pas pu être réaffectés).
Overmind
@Overmind considère votre p.1 Pourquoi comparez-vous la valeur "brute" à la valeur "actuelle"? On dirait que vous venez de comparer ce qui correspond le plus, en ignorant les titres de colonnes. Cela n'a aucun sens. Essayez également d'appliquer cette approche à d'autres lignes - et vous obtiendrez encore plus de bêtises.
Dims
Ne sois pas confus. Les valeurs brutes peuvent être totalement différentes des autres (certaines sont même composites / 2n1 comme F0), elles peuvent rarement être comparées directement. Beaucoup de Raws ne sont que des compteurs pour diverses choses qui n'affectent même pas le statut SMART.
Overmind
@ Overmind mais pourquoi comparez-vous 0xFB3 avec 2 alors? Vous avez dit que "la valeur des secteurs réaffectés est de 4019 ... dépasse de beaucoup 2", c'est-à-dire que vous avez comparé.
Dim